About Carstenz
- Carstenz Pyramid part of Mimika Region, in West Papua Province Republic Of Indonesia
- Carstenz Pyramid is part of Lorenze National Park and Sudirman Range, and side by side with Grassberg Open pit Freeport Inc.
- Carstenz Pyramid is lime stone big wall (Less more 600 meter)
- Carstenz Pyramid condition & Weather is un predictable, it can be 1-3 days raining, snowing, and Cloudy.
- Base Camp to summit track condition is sand, rock, sliding rock, water slide, and sometimes snow.
- Summit ridge (4600 M) lime stone.
- Carstenz Pyramid is Tehnical rock climbing route

SUMMIT DAY INFORMATION (Carstenz Pyramid Normal Route)
- 24.00 - 00.50 am, wake up & preparing
- 01.00 - 01.50 am, BC to the pitch 1
- 02.00 - 05.30 am, pitch 1, pitch 2, pitch 3, pitch 4 and Traversing
- 05.30 - 07.00 am, traversing to the pitch 5
- 07.00 - 09.00 am, pitch 5 to summit ridge
- 09.00 - 11.00 am, Summit ridge to summit
- 11.00 - 11.30 am, Summit ceremonial
- 11.30 - 15.00 pm, Summit to BC
Note: CimbingTime depending Physical Condition, Individual Skill, climbing tactic, and Total Climber.
NECESSARY EQUIPMENT
Headwear:
1 sun hat (it must shade the eyes and nose). 1 balaclava (wool, polypropylene). 1 wool or fleece hat. 1 pair glacier glasses with side protection (and a spare). 1 neck gaiter.
Upper - Lower body:
1 expedition down parka with hood (-20 F). 1 windproof outer jacket with hood (Gore-tex)
1 poly/fleece jacket. 1 expedition weight polypropylene shirt. 2 lightweight, long sleeve polypropylene shirts. 2 heavy polypropylene long underwear (tops and bottoms). 2 t-shirts for lower elevations. 1 pair wind/rain pants (with side zips). 1 pair fleece pants (side zipper). 1 long cotton pant for trekking (legs zip off to become shorts). 1 nylon shorts
Handwear:
2 pairs liner gloves (poly thin). 1 pair medium weight fleece gloves. 1 pair goretex wind shells for mittens. 1 pair wool or fleece mittens. 1 pair overmitts.
Footwear:
1 pair of trekking boots (Gore-tex) and 1 quality sport shoes . 1 pair of sandals
1 pair insulated super-gaiters. 2-3 pair of wool socks and polypropylene socks. 3 pairs polypropylene, wool or similar socks.
Sleeping Gear: 1 down or synthetic sleeping bag (-20C).
Pack:
High quality back pack approx. 70-80 liters. Day pack for approach hike and summit day. 1 Large duffel bag (7000+cu.in) with lock to be carried to Base Camp.
Climbing Equipment:
Sit Harness, 1 pair Jumar, Descenduer figur of eight, 2 Carabineer Screw Gate & 5 Snap gate, 5 Webbing 1,5 meter, 2 prusik, Climbing Helmet, Head Lamp with 3 alkaline battery sets)
Misc:
Sun screen and lip protection (UV rating of 20 SPF or more). Metal thermos bottle, 1000ml. Toiletry kit. Water bottle. Camera and film. Pocket knife (mid size). Book and walkman to spend time in tent. Simple first aid kit. Pee bottle - 1 qt. capacity, wide mouth. Insect repellant coating for hike in clothes. Passport. Cash. Copies of relevant documents (maps, directions, itinerary, etc... all in plastic bags). Journal with pens. Casual clothes for walking around, going to dinner. Small Indonesia dictionary with travel phrases.
